Why Mini Carrot Pancakes Are Great for Babies

  • Packed with Veggies: The carrots add essential vitamins and fiber to these pancakes, making them both nutritious and delicious.

  • Soft and Baby-Friendly: The mini size and soft texture make these pancakes easy for your baby to pick up and chew.

  • Naturally Sweetened: No added sugar – the sweetness of carrots is all you need for these pancakes.

  • Perfect for BLW: These mini pancakes are great for self-feeding and are easy for babies to grasp.

 


Recipe: Mini Carrot Pancakes for Babies

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up finely grated carrots (about 1 small carrot)

  • 1/2 cup whole wheat flour (or oat flour for a gluten-free option)

  • 1/2 teaspoon baking powder

  • 1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on (optional)

  • 1 egg (or egg substitute for allergies)

  • 1/4 cup unsweetened applesauce (or Greek yogurt for added protein)

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il or coconut oil (for cooking)

  • 1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ract (optional)

 


 

Instructions:

Step 1: Prepare the Carrots
Grate the carrot finely and set it aside. You can also steam or lightly cook the carrots before grating them for an extra soft texture if preferred.

Step 2: Mix the Wet Ingredients
In a medium-sized bowl, whisk together the egg (or egg substitute), applesauce (or yogurt), and vanilla extract (if using). Mix well until smooth.

Step 3: Add the Dry Ingredients
In another bowl, combine the whole wheat flour, baking powder, and cinnamon.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, stirring until well combined.

Step 4: Stir in the Carrots
Fold the grated carrots into the pancake batter until evenly distributed.

Step 5: Cook the Mini Pancakes
Heat a non-stick pan over medium heat and lightly grease with olive oil or coconut oil. Using a tablespoon or small spoon, scoop out small portions of batter and drop them into the pan, making little pancakes. Cook for 2-3 minutes on each side, until golden brown and cooked through.

Step 6: Cool and Serve
Allow the mini pancakes to cool slightly before serving to your baby. Serve them in small, bite-sized portions that are easy for little hands to hold.

 


 

Serving Tips

  • Serve with fruit: Pair these mini pancakes with some fresh fruit slices like banana, strawberries, or blueberries for extra nutrients.

  • For extra protein: Serve with a small dollop of plain yogurt or a scrambled egg on the side.

  • Store for later: These mini carrot pancakes can be stored in an airtight container for up to 3 days in the fridge or frozen for later use. Simply reheat before serving.
